














[SN J784254] USED GRECO / SA700 Walnut [06]
The pickups are Duncan models, featuring the classic combination of a JB at the bridge and a Jazz at the neck. The tuning pegs have been replaced with locking pegs, and the bridge and tailpiece have also been upgraded to GOTOH components.
There is a widespread deposit on the body top that appears to be a re-finish.
Cracks are visible all around the binding, and there are signs that areas where the binding had peeled off were repaired and then roughly over-lacquered. Since there are areas where paint splatter from this process remains on the top and others where attempts to wipe it off failed, the surface finish is rough and does not look clean when viewed up close. Additionally, the binding on the neck side near the 1st string has been patched where it peeled off, and there are signs of a neck refinish.Since the color of the added binding is pure white, it does not match the rest of the instrument in some areas.
Otherwise, there are scratches and dents throughout the instrument that have been covered by the finish, giving it a distinctive, well-worn character.
Condition Grade: B: Shows significant scratches and signs of wear, but is suitable for normal use
Serial Number: J784254
Case: Non-original soft case (with Epiphone logo)
Weight: 3.70 kg
Truss Rod: No issues; checked up to 60 degrees to the left and right with no problems
Remaining Fret Height: Within normal range; fret height is sufficient for playing
String Height (Low String Side): 1.8 mm at the 12th fret
String Height (Treble Side): 1.5 mm at the 12th fret
Strings at Setup: ERNIE BALL 2221 / .010-.046 set
Repairs and Maintenance Performed: Cleaning, string replacement, truss rod adjustment, octave adjustment, string height adjustment, and fret leveling
